Based on the fluid phase equilibrium of the C-O-H system,the compositions of various fluid phases under high temperatures and pressures have been calculated in terms of the available thermodynamic data and new P-V-T data and on the assumption of PT=∑Pi in this paper.The results indicate that in this system there are 5 major fluid phases in different proportions at various T and P.Ch4 is the dominant phase(about 70%) under relatively lower T and P.Its proportion obviously decreases with increasing T,P and fo2.The results provide sufficient theoretical grounds for discussing the possibility of CH4 formation and the physical-chemical conditions of its stable occurrence and proportion in the geological environment.
